Запуск в Ubuntu
|
|
Roamer | Дата: Четверг, 23.01.2014, 16:45 | Сообщение # 1 |
Группа: Проверенные
Сообщений: 3
Статус: Оффлайн
| Добрый день. Скачал вашу программу, но запустить так и не смог (ни клиента, ни конфиг сервера, ни сам сервер). Файлы по каталогам lib перенёс. Хотел просто попробовать пока без автоматических запусков(daemon), так сказать на коленке(проверить в качестве альтернативы ORIONу). Ubuntu 13.10 (64 битка), как доп ОС на домашнем компьютере(поэтому на ней и пробовал). Что я делаю не так? P.S. Работаю в отделе по ремонту и обслуживанию ОПС и видеонаблюдения. ORION достал, хочется альтернативы (без SQL серверов)
|
|
| |
arm-skif | Дата: Пятница, 24.01.2014, 09:58 | Сообщение # 2 |
Группа: Администраторы
Сообщений: 835
Статус: Оффлайн
| Добрый день. Скорее всего не установлена библиотека Qt. Попробуйте запустить программы в консоли (./ClientSkif) - сразу станет ясно каких библиотек не хватает. Я вечером попробую в Ubuntu.
|
|
| |
arm-skif | Дата: Суббота, 25.01.2014, 00:07 | Сообщение # 3 |
Группа: Администраторы
Сообщений: 835
Статус: Оффлайн
| Должны быть установлены пакеты: libqt4-core, libqt4-gui, libqt4-network. В ubuntu почему-то нет библиотеки qtMultimedia (нужна для ClienSkif). Попробую разобраться. Конфигуратор сервера не запускается потому что библиотеки из архива программы нужно скопировать не в /usr/lib/qt4/, а в /usr/lib/ В разных линуксах по разному
|
|
| |
Roamer | Дата: Суббота, 25.01.2014, 00:47 | Сообщение # 4 |
Группа: Проверенные
Сообщений: 3
Статус: Оффлайн
| Пакеты доустановил, файлы из (lib/QtSerialport, lib/QtService) закинул в /usr/lib (без каталогов), Конфигуратор сервера запустился
|
|
| |
arm-skif | Дата: Суббота, 25.01.2014, 12:25 | Сообщение # 5 |
Группа: Администраторы
Сообщений: 835
Статус: Оффлайн
| На главной добавил новость: Цитата Выяснилось, что в ОС Ununtu нет библиотеки qtMultimedia, которая нужна для правильной работы программы "ClientSkif". Для linux добавлена возможность вывода звука при помощи библиотеки Phonon. Версия программы не изменилась (2.0.1), но в архив добавлен файл "ClientSkif-phonon". Должно работать.
Доделаю программу для компьютера raspberry pi, потом займусь документацией и тестированием для разных версий linux.
|
|
| |
arm-skif | Дата: Суббота, 25.01.2014, 13:00 | Сообщение # 6 |
Группа: Администраторы
Сообщений: 835
Статус: Оффлайн
| Проверил, с железом работает. Если что-то не работает - смотрите логи в папке "log". Для работы с последовательными портами нужно добавить пользователя в группу dialout командой: Код sudo usermod -a -G dialout username username - заменить на вашего пользователя.
|
|
| |
Roamer | Дата: Понедельник, 17.02.2014, 16:18 | Сообщение # 7 |
Группа: Проверенные
Сообщений: 3
Статус: Оффлайн
| Цитата arm-skif ( ) Для linux добавлена возможность вывода звука при помощи библиотеки Phonon. Версия программы не изменилась (2.0.1), но в архив добавлен файл "ClientSkif-phonon".Должно работать. Извините, что долго молчал. С ClientSkif-phonon всё заработало.Добавлено (17.02.2014, 16:18) --------------------------------------------- И ещё один вопрос. Работа вашей программы в UBUNTU не принципиальна (из-за тяжеловесности дистрибутива), возможно вы порекомендуете другой дистрибутив для работы с АРМ "Скиф". (на ПК) Вариант для Rasberry PI тоже рассмотрю, но для начала, надо его у нас в городе найти ))), или закажу через инет
|
|
| |
arm-skif | Дата: Понедельник, 17.02.2014, 16:38 | Сообщение # 8 |
Группа: Администраторы
Сообщений: 835
Статус: Оффлайн
| Должно работать в любом дистрибутиве linux, но нужно пробовать т.к. линуксы немного отличаются друг от друга. Лично я использую www.calculate-linux.ru, но он тяжеловат для начинающих т.к. там нет графического пакетного менеджера. Еще мне нравится openSUSE.
Некоторым пользователям я бесплатно высылаю лицензию на программу, но только для Rasberry Pi. Вот и вам предложил. Для Rasberry нужен лицензионный файл, а не аппаратный ключ защиты. Проще подарить файл чем ключ, поэтому подарки для Rasberry Pi
|
|
| |
arm-skif | Дата: Понедельник, 17.02.2014, 16:44 | Сообщение # 9 |
Группа: Администраторы
Сообщений: 835
Статус: Оффлайн
| На Rasberry немного притормаживает графический интерфейс из-за невозможности задействовать аппаратное ускорение видеокарты (когда-нибудь исправлю). Но всегда можно установить клиентское ПО на другом ПК, а Rasberry использовать как сервер.
|
|
| |
Sanyka | Дата: Среда, 26.03.2014, 23:16 | Сообщение # 10 |
Группа: Проверенные
Сообщений: 43
Статус: Оффлайн
| Добавлю информацию: пока не работает на ubuntu ниже 13 версии, спасибо arm-skif за разъяснения. Так же обращу внимание что работа серверной части возможна пока только на x86-64 дистрибутивах.
Из вики : Набор команд x86-64 в настоящее время поддерживается: - AMD — процессорами Z-серии (например, AMD Z-03), C-серии (например, AMD C-60), G-серии (например, AMD T56N), E-серии (например, AMD E-450), E1, E2, A4, A6, A8, A10, FX, Athlon 64, Athlon 64 FX, Athlon 64 X2, Athlon II, Phenom, Phenom II, Turion 64, Turion 64 X2, Turion II, Opteron, последними моделями Sempron;
- Intel (с незначительными упрощениями) под названием «Intel 64» (ранее известные как «EM64T» и «IA-32e») в поздних моделях процессоров Pentium 4, а также в Pentium D, Pentium Extreme Edition, Celeron D, Celeron G-серии, Celeron B-серии, Pentium Dual-Core, Pentium T-серии, Pentium P-серии, Pentium G-серии, Pentium B-серии, Core 2 Duo, Core 2 Quad, Core 2 Extreme, Core i3, Core i5, Core i7, Atom (далеко не всеми) и Xeon;
- VIA — процессорами Nano, Eden, QuadCore.
Сообщение отредактировал Sanyka - Среда, 26.03.2014, 23:22 |
|
| |
Sershv | Дата: Понедельник, 21.07.2014, 11:20 | Сообщение # 11 |
Группа: Проверенные
Сообщений: 3
Статус: Оффлайн
| Здравствуйте. Не работает на Debian 7.6 Wheezy ядро Linux 3.2.0-4-amd64
./ConfigServer ./ConfigServer: error while loading shared libraries: libudev.so.1: cannot open shared object file: No such file or directory
./ClientSkif-phonon ./ClientSkif-phonon: error while loading shared libraries: libphonon.so.4: cannot open shared object file: No such file or directory
./ClientSkif ./ClientSkif: error while loading shared libraries: libQtMultimedia.so.4: cannot open shared object file: No such file or directory
|
|
| |
arm-skif | Дата: Понедельник, 21.07.2014, 11:39 | Сообщение # 12 |
Группа: Администраторы
Сообщений: 835
Статус: Оффлайн
| Здравствуйте. Попробуйте скачать программу в разделе ДЛЯ ASTRA LINUX X86-64. Еще установите пакет libphonon4. Я сейчас в отпуске, на отдыхе, сильно не помогу. Если не заработает, дней через 10 сделаю сборку для этого дистрибутива.
|
|
| |
Sershv | Дата: Понедельник, 21.07.2014, 15:48 | Сообщение # 13 |
Группа: Проверенные
Сообщений: 3
Статус: Оффлайн
| ДЛЯ ASTRA LINUX X86-64 помогло Добавлено (21.07.2014, 15:48) --------------------------------------------- А нет библиотек для Astra Linux x86? А то на Debian 6.0.9 Squeeze ядро Linux 2.6.32-5-686 не работает с теми же симптомами как Debian 7.6 Wheezy ядро Linux 3.2.0-4-amd64 выше
|
|
| |
arm-skif | Дата: Суббота, 02.08.2014, 10:05 | Сообщение # 14 |
Группа: Администраторы
Сообщений: 835
Статус: Оффлайн
| В Debian 6.0.9 слишком старая версия Qt. Нужна минимум 4.8.
|
|
| |
arm-skif | Дата: Суббота, 30.08.2014, 15:23 | Сообщение # 15 |
Группа: Администраторы
Сообщений: 835
Статус: Оффлайн
| Перенес часть сообщений в новую тему: Одноплатный копьютер Raspberry Pi.
|
|
| |
alexapod75 | Дата: Четверг, 18.06.2015, 19:54 | Сообщение # 16 |
Группа: Проверенные
Сообщений: 25
Статус: Оффлайн
| Добрый день. У меня такой вопрос: как в клиенте на линукс изменить размер окна приложения? На ноуте с разрешением монитора 1366 х 768 по высоте окно приложения не влезает в монитор. Заранее благодарю. Версия ПО 2.6
Сообщение отредактировал alexapod75 - Четверг, 18.06.2015, 19:56 |
|
| |
arm-skif | Дата: Пятница, 19.06.2015, 09:22 | Сообщение # 17 |
Группа: Администраторы
Сообщений: 835
Статус: Оффлайн
| Добрый день. Количество кнопок незаметно выросло, поэтому программа не помещается по высоте. На windows так же. Сделаю перекомпоновку.
|
|
| |
arm-skif | Дата: Суббота, 20.06.2015, 00:03 | Сообщение # 18 |
Группа: Администраторы
Сообщений: 835
Статус: Оффлайн
| Попробуйте.
|
|
| |
alexapod75 | Дата: Суббота, 20.06.2015, 01:45 | Сообщение # 19 |
Группа: Проверенные
Сообщений: 25
Статус: Оффлайн
| Попробовал. Перестал запускаться клиент. А конфигуратор АРМ не влезает полностью.
Сообщение отредактировал alexapod75 - Суббота, 20.06.2015, 01:53 |
|
| |
arm-skif | Дата: Суббота, 20.06.2015, 01:59 | Сообщение # 20 |
Группа: Администраторы
Сообщений: 835
Статус: Оффлайн
| А если в консоли запустить клиент, то что пишет?
Мне кажется что либо файл некорректно распаковался, либо неправильные права на файл.
|
|
| |
alexapod75 | Дата: Среда, 12.08.2015, 22:54 | Сообщение # 21 |
Группа: Проверенные
Сообщений: 25
Статус: Оффлайн
| Прошу прощения, соврал. Все работает как надо. И phonon библиотеки и libqt4 библиотеки устанавливать обязательно в Mint.
Добавлено (12.08.2015, 22:53) --------------------------------------------- Добрый вечер, файлы заново не загрузите, а то на сервере их нет уже.Цитата arm-skif ( ) Попробуйте.
Сообщение отредактировал alexapod75 - Среда, 12.08.2015, 23:04 |
|
| |
Smoker_vvo | Дата: Вторник, 07.06.2016, 12:54 | Сообщение # 22 |
Группа: Проверенные
Сообщений: 37
Статус: Оффлайн
| А можно пошаговый HELP по установке на Ubuntu. Сервер не нужен, нужен просто клиент, типа запустил и обратился к серверу.
|
|
| |
arm-skif | Дата: Вторник, 07.06.2016, 13:01 | Сообщение # 23 |
Группа: Администраторы
Сообщений: 835
Статус: Оффлайн
| Нужно установить пакеты: libphonon4, libqt4-core, libqt4-gui, libqt4-network, libqt4-script
Дальше распакуйте архив со Скифом в папку /home/Skif и запустите ClientSkif.
Если не запускается, то запустите в консоли и посмотрите на какую библиотеку ругается. Еще может не запускаться если у файла снят атрибут что он исполняемый.
|
|
| |
Smoker_vvo | Дата: Вторник, 07.06.2016, 13:50 | Сообщение # 24 |
Группа: Проверенные
Сообщений: 37
Статус: Оффлайн
| Так, запустилось, Спасиба!! Добавлено (07.06.2016, 13:32) --------------------------------------------- Но подключиться к серверу - нет. в логах сервера - тишина Добавлено (07.06.2016, 13:33) --------------------------------------------- В настройках указываю существующий сервер и пароль который прописал на сервере для этого АРМ, правильно?? Добавлено (07.06.2016, 13:50) --------------------------------------------- Посмотрел логи - нет попытьк обращения с другого компа..... УРААААА!! Заработало!! В Брандмауре ВИндовз прописал разрешение на ServerSkif.....
|
|
| |